The Legal Basis for Phone Seizures in France

The legal basis for phone seizures in France during drug-related investigations stems from several articles within the French penal code. These articles grant law enforcement authorities the power to conduct searches and seizures, including the seizure of mobile phones, under specific circumstances. The process requires careful adherence to due process and judicial oversight.

  • Specific articles of the French penal code authorizing searches and seizures: Articles such as those concerning the investigation of drug trafficking offenses (e.g., articles related to possession, trafficking, and distribution) provide the legal foundation for these actions.   • Conditions under which a warrant can be issued: A warrant, issued by an investigating judge (juge d'instruction), is typically required before a phone seizure can take place. The warrant must specify the grounds for the seizure, the specific phone to be seized, and the duration of the seizure. The warrant must demonstrate probable cause linking the phone to drug-related criminal activity.
  • Role of the investigating judge (juge d'instruction): The investigating judge plays a crucial role in overseeing the legality and proportionality of phone seizures. They ensure that the seizure is justified and respects the rights of the individual.
  • Legal recourse available to individuals whose phones are seized: Individuals whose phones are seized have legal recourse. They can challenge the legality of the seizure before a court, arguing that the warrant was improperly obtained or that the seizure was disproportionate to the alleged offense.

Privacy Concerns and Ethical Implications of Phone Seizures in France

The extensive use of phone seizures raises significant privacy concerns. The seizure and analysis of an individual's phone can reveal a vast amount of personal data, potentially exposing private communications, financial information, and personal relationships.

  • Arguments for and against the extensive use of phone seizures: The debate centers around the balance between the need to combat drug trafficking and the protection of individual privacy rights. Arguments for emphasize public safety and the effectiveness of this investigative tool; arguments against highlight the potential for abuse and violation of fundamental rights.
  • Potential for misuse or abuse of this power: Concerns exist regarding the potential for misuse of phone seizure powers, including targeting individuals based on bias or without sufficient justification. Robust oversight mechanisms are crucial to mitigate this risk.
  • Discussion of data protection regulations and their application: French data protection laws, such as the GDPR, must be carefully considered in the context of phone seizures. The legal framework must ensure compliance with these regulations and protect the rights of individuals.
  • Debate on the proportionality of phone seizures in relation to the alleged offenses: The proportionality of seizing a phone must be assessed in relation to the severity of the alleged offense. Seizing a phone for a minor drug offense might be considered disproportionate, raising further ethical questions.
